Parrots come from the household Psittacidae, which includes approximately 393 types, contributing to their varied variety. These birds are identified by their strong, curved beaks, an upright stance, strong legs, and a capability to mimic sounds, including human speech. Parrots are found in tropical and subtropical regions around the globe, making them a typical sight in locations with lush greenery.

Parrot Habitat and Distribution
Parrots can be discovered in a variety of environments, consisting of:

Rainforests: Most types grow in the dense canopies of tropical rainforests, where they discover abundant food sources.

Woodlands: Some types occupy semi-arid areas with scattered trees.

Savannas: Parrots can frequently be seen foraging outdoors grasslands where they look for seeds and fruits.

Parrots are known for their complex social structures and habits. In the wild, they usually form flocks varying from a few to a number of hundred birds. These social groups assist offer safety from predators along with friendship.
Key Behavioral Traits:
Mimicking Ability: Parrots are renowned for their ability to simulate human speech and other noises they hear in their environment.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How can I train my parrot to talk?
Training needs patience and consistency. Repeat words and phrases routinely, rewarding your parrot for imitating them.
Q2: Do parrots need a buddy?
Parrots are social animals and can gain from having a buddy, whether it's another parrot or plenty of interaction with their owners.
Q3: What should I do if my parrot is plucking its plumes?
Plume plucking can be an indication of tension or monotony. Consult with a bird veterinarian to identify the underlying cause and establish a treatment strategy.
Q4: How can I guarantee my parrot is safe while flying?
Supervised flight sessions in a safe environment, like a bird-proofed space or outdoor aviaries, can assist ensure your parrot is safe while flying.
Q5: What kinds of toys are best for parrots?
Offer toys that engage their physical and brainpowers, such as puzzles, chewable products, and ropes for climbing.
